{{rfdef}}.- 1860, Reports of Cases, H. Sweet, page 110
That the Commissioners shall from time to time appdnt a treasurer, clerk, surveyor, collector and assessor, beadle, streetkeeper, and such other officers as they shall think fit, with such salaries and allowances as they think reasonable. - 2013, Holloway, Emma Jane, A study in Darkness, Del Rey, page 52
The Schoolmaster gave him a sharp look. “I’ve heard about you. You’re the streetkeeper who bit the hand that fed him.” - 2012, Hicks, Gary, The First Adman, Victorian Secrets, page 101
An attempt to put up a billboard in Palace Yard by the old House of Commons at Westminster failed, ‘the streetkeeper not permitting it, it was fetched away and carried to Mr. Bish’s Office, Charing Cross’. - 1993, Memories of Knysna, Friends of the Knysna Libraries, page 33
A certain Mr Barnard, the streetkeeper, had the job of lighting these lamps every evening. - 2011, Morton, James, The First Detective, Overlook Press, page 45
The convoy made its way to Senlis where the jailer doubled as streetkeeper and the prison was left in the command of his formidable wife. - 1908, Theal, George McCall, History of South Africa since September 1795, Sonnenschein, page 83
The municipality appointed a special streetkeeper to each of these districts, whose duty it was to see that destitute sick persons were conveyed to the hospitals and to enforce cleanliness.
